How do I end an item early to sell to someone at agreed price?

12 replies

SpecialOffer · 21/11/2008 16:14

Someone has offered me an amount to end the auction early and sell to them through e-bay at the price. My item has bids on it, can I do this?

OP posts:
Report
twocutedarlings · 21/11/2008 16:17

Not really, as it already has bids on it.

You could however cancel the current bids and then add a buy it now price, but tbh this wouldnt really be right way to do things.

Report
Marne · 21/11/2008 16:19

as twocute said, you could cancel bids and add buy it now, or cancel the listing and relist with buy it now.

Report
AnAngelWithin · 21/11/2008 16:20

get them to bid up to the agreed price then you can end the listing early with the reason of 'decided to sell to the current highest bidder' that way it all still goes through ebay.

Report
twocutedarlings · 21/11/2008 16:24

It would all go through ebay anyway AAW.
